    In this episode, Stef breaks down her proprietary RICH Framework for mentorship, the exact system she's used to mentor high-achieving women to build multi-million dollar businesses. But here's the thing: most people in network marketing have NO IDEA what real mentorship actually looks like. They confuse it with coaching, therapy, and accountability, and that confusion is burning people out and giving the industry a bad rep.

    If you're new in business and think you need to mentor everyone, this episode is your wake-up call. And if you're already mentoring, this framework will change how you show up for your team.


    What You'll Learn:

    • The 4 pillars of the RICH Framework: Relationship, Intention, Capacity, and Habits
    • The critical difference between mentorship, coaching, therapy, and accountability
    • Why new network marketers need to STOP trying to mentor when they're still babies themselves
    • The layered leadership approach and why apprenticeship is the key to sustainable success
    • How nervous system capacity determines whether you'll hold success or self-sabotage
    • Why your intentions matter more than your goals (and how to uncover them)
    • The consistency habits that actually build wealth vs. the busy work that keeps you broke

    Episode Overview

    In this raw and powerful episode, Stef gets real about what's actually holding you back in business (spoiler: it's not a "block"). She shares the darkest four months of her life and how self-discipline (rooted in radical self-love) literally saved her business, her sanity, and her life.


    What You'll Learn

    The Truth About "Blocks"

    • Why you don't actually have a block, you have a nervous system keeping you comfortable
    • What's really happening in your brain when you feel stuck
    • The gap between where you are and where you want to be isn't about more inner work

    Self-Discipline as Self-Love

    • Why self-discipline is the most radical act of self-love you can practice
    • How discipline means choosing future you over present comfort
    • The difference between toxic hustle and sustainable structure

    The Reality of Building a Business

    • Why you need BOTH feminine energy AND masculine structure to succeed
    • The difference between operating like an influencer vs. a business owner
    • Why "just feel into it" advice is setting you up to fail
    • The unsexy basics that actually build sustainable success

    Stef's Story

    • How she survived the darkest months of her life while running a seven-figure business
    • The tool she used multiple times daily to move through resistance (The 5-Second Rule)
    • What showing up looked like when everything was falling apart
    • How discipline built unshakeable self-trust

    Exhausted from micromanaging your team while they still don't take action? This episode is why your team isn't duplicating your results and why it's not your fault.

    If you've ever thought "why isn't my team showing up like I do?" or "am I failing as a leader?" you're carrying guilt that was never yours to carry.

    I'm breaking down:

    • Why duplication actually fails in most businesses
    • John Maxwell's Law of the Lid and what it means for your leadership
    • The neuroscience behind why we get addicted to rescuing our teams (oxytocin and dopamine are keeping you stuck)
    • How to stop being everyone's mom and start building leaders who take ownership

    This is for the entrepreneur who's done everything "right" but is still doing all the heavy lifting. It's time to build a self-sufficient team.
